Brazilian Brown Bat vs Dame'S Rocket Moth
Eptesicus brasiliensis compared with Plutella porrectella
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brazilian Brown Bat | Dame'S Rocket Moth |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Plutellidae |
| Genus | Eptesicus | Plutella |
| Species | Eptesicus brasiliensis | Plutella porrectella |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brazilian Brown Bat and Dame'S Rocket Moth share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
